Приветствую Вас на сайте Info-Comp.ru! В этом материале я собрал 20 лучших своих статей, посвященных работе с Microsoft SQL Server. Подборка ориентирована на администраторов, которые выполняют различные задачи администрирования баз данных и управления SQL сервером.
Данная подборка статей поможет Вам повысить свой уровень знаний Microsoft SQL Server, так как здесь присутствуют статьи разной направленности и с разным уровнем сложности, начиная от инструкций по установке SQL Server и заканчивая написанием различных T-SQL инструкций для выполнения и автоматизации административных задач.
Все статьи написаны лично мной и расположены они на этом же сайте в открытом доступе, поэтому Вам не требуется посещать какие-то сторонние ресурсы, для того чтобы прочитать их.
В данной подборке статьи никак не упорядочены, можете читать их в произвольном порядке.
Если Вас интересует язык T-SQL, то рекомендую ознакомиться со следующими подборками:
- ТОП 30 статей для изучения языка T-SQL – Уровень «Начинающий»
- ТОП 20 статей для изучения языка T-SQL – Уровень «Продвинутый»
- ТОП 20 статей для изучения языка T-SQL – Уровень «Эксперт»
Итак, давайте приступать.
- Установка Microsoft SQL Server на Windows
- Установка Microsoft SQL Server на Linux Ubuntu Server
- Установка SQL Server Management Studio
- Создание и удаление пользователей
- Сжатие базы данных и журнала транзакций
- Отсоединение и присоединение баз данных
- Перемещение файлов базы данных на другой диск
- Настройка компонента Database Mail
- Настройка связанного сервера с Oracle
- Полнотекстовый поиск (Full-Text Search)
- Системная процедура sp_configure
- Массовое перестроение индексов (переиндексация БД)
- Как узнать размер базы данных
- Как получить список баз данных
- Как получить список всех таблиц в базе данных
- Как сгенерировать SQL скрипт создания объектов и данных
- Как узнать дату и время запуска или перезапуска SQL Server
- Как узнать, относится ли пользователь к определенной группе или роли
- Обращение к Excel из Microsoft SQL Server
- Сравнение и синхронизация баз данных
Установка Microsoft SQL Server на Windows
Статья – Установка Microsoft SQL Server 2019 Express на Windows 10
В данной статье подробно рассмотрен процесс установки Microsoft SQL Server 2019 Express и SQL Server Management Studio (SSMS) на операционную систему Windows 10, также
Вы узнаете, где скачать данную СУБД.
Установка Microsoft SQL Server на Linux Ubuntu Server
Статья – Установка Microsoft SQL Server 2017 Express на Linux Ubuntu Server 18.04
Microsoft SQL Server, начиная с 2017 версии, поддерживает работу на операционной системе Linux, в этой статье подробно рассказано о том, как установить Microsoft SQL Server 2017 в редакции Express на Linux Ubuntu Server 18.04.
Установка SQL Server Management Studio
Статья – Обзор и установка SQL Server Management Studio 17
Из данного материала Вы узнаете, что такое SSMS, какие особенности у среды SQL Server Management Studio, а также как установить SSMS на компьютер.
Создание и удаление пользователей
Статья – Создание и удаление пользователей в Microsoft SQL Server
В этом материале рассмотрены примеры создания и удаления пользователей в Microsoft SQL Server как с использованием инструкций T-SQL, так и с использованием среды SQL Server Management Studio.
Сжатие базы данных и журнала транзакций
Статья – Сжатие базы данных и журнала транзакций в Microsoft SQL Server
Сжатие БД — это процесс удаления неиспользуемого пространства в файлах базы данных и журнала транзакций.
Если Вы столкнулись с проблемой значительного увеличения физического размера базы данных и файлов журнала транзакций, то, возможно, Вам поможет процедура сжатия БД, тем самым Вам не нужно будет предпринимать какие-либо действия, связанные с увеличением свободного пространства на жестком диске.
Из данного материала Вы узнаете, как выполнить процедуру сжатия базы данных в Microsoft SQL Server.
Отсоединение и присоединение баз данных
Статья – Отсоединение и присоединение баз данных в Microsoft SQL Server (Detach и Attach)
В Microsoft SQL Server есть возможность отсоединения и присоединения базы данных, в этом материале мы рассмотрим, в каких случаях эта возможность будет нам полезна и, конечно же, рассмотрим примеры реализации данной возможности, причем разными способами.
Перемещение файлов базы данных на другой диск
Статья – Как переместить файлы базы данных Microsoft SQL Server на другой диск?
В данном материале мы рассмотрим возможность перемещения файлов базы данных Microsoft SQL Server на новый жесткий диск с помощью инструкции ALTER DATABASE…MODIFY FILE.
Настройка компонента Database Mail
Статья – Настройка компонента Database Mail в Microsoft SQL Server
В данной статье рассмотрен компонент Database Mail, входящий в состав Microsoft SQL Server, Вы узнаете, что это за компонент, для чего он нужен, как его настроить и, конечно же, как им пользоваться.
Настройка связанного сервера с Oracle
Статья – Настройка связанного сервера с Oracle в Microsoft SQL Server
Microsoft SQL Server позволяет обращаться к различным источникам данных, которые расположены вне SQL сервера, это возможно благодаря технологии связанных серверов. В этом материале рассмотрен пример настройки связанного сервера с СУБД Oracle.
Полнотекстовый поиск (Full-Text Search)
Статья – Полнотекстовый поиск (Full-Text Search) в Microsoft SQL Server
В этой статье рассмотрен компонент Full-Text Search Microsoft SQL Server, с помощью которого можно реализовать полнотекстовый поиск.
Полнотекстовый поиск – это поиск слов или фраз в текстовых данных.
Системная процедура sp_configure
Статья – Системная процедура sp_configure — установка параметров конфигурации в Microsoft SQL Server
В Microsoft SQL Server для управления ресурсами сервера используются параметры конфигурации, в данном материале рассмотрена системная хранимая процедура sp_configure, с помощью которой можно просматривать и изменять эти параметры.
Массовое перестроение индексов (переиндексация БД)
Статья – Массовое перестроение индексов в Microsoft SQL Server (переиндексация БД)
В этом материале рассмотрен пример реализации процедуры для массовой переиндексации (перестроение, реорганизация индексов) базы данных в Microsoft SQL Server.
Данная процедура поможет Вам автоматизировать процесс обслуживания индексов в БД, при этом в ней учтены рекомендации Microsoft по поводу того, когда выполнять перестроение индексов, а когда их реорганизацию (на основе степени фрагментации).
Как узнать размер базы данных
Статья – Как узнать размер базы данных в Microsoft SQL Server?
Из данного материала Вы узнаете несколько способов, как можно определить размер базы данных в Microsoft SQL Server.
Как получить список баз данных
Статья – Как получить список баз данных в Microsoft SQL Server на T-SQL?
В этой статье рассмотрено два способа, как можно получить список баз данных на языке T-SQL в Microsoft SQL Server. Первый способ заключается в использовании системного представления sys.databases, второй — в использовании системной хранимой процедуры sp_helpdb.
Как получить список всех таблиц в базе данных
Статья – Как получить список всех таблиц в базе данных Microsoft SQL Server?
Из данной статьи Вы узнаете несколько способов, как можно получить список всех пользовательских таблиц в Microsoft SQL Server, включая некоторые их характеристики с помощью SQL запроса.
Как сгенерировать SQL скрипт создания объектов и данных
Статья – Как сгенерировать SQL скрипт создания объектов и данных в Microsoft SQL Server?
Из данного материала Вы узнаете, как сгенерировать SQL скрипт создания объектов базы данных Microsoft SQL Server, используя графическую среду SQL Server Management Studio (SSMS). Также Вы узнаете, что вообще такое SQL скрипт объектов базы данных.
Как узнать дату и время запуска или перезапуска SQL Server
Статья – Как узнать дату и время запуска или перезапуска Microsoft SQL Server?
В этом материале представлено несколько способов, как можно узнать дату и время запуска или перезапуска Microsoft SQL Server, так как иногда данная информация бывает очень полезной.
Как узнать, относится ли пользователь к определенной группе или роли
В данной статье рассмотрены функции IS_MEMBER и IS_SRVROLEMEMBER языка T-SQL, с помощью которых можно определить принадлежность пользователя к группе или роли.
Обращение к Excel из Microsoft SQL Server
Статья – Импорт данных из Excel в Microsoft SQL Server на языке T-SQL
Из данного материала Вы узнаете, как из Microsoft SQL Server встроенными средствами языка T-SQL обратиться к данным в файле Excel, а также какие условия для этого необходимо выполнить.
Сравнение и синхронизация баз данных
Статья – Как сравнить и синхронизировать две базы данных в Microsoft SQL Server?
В этом материале рассмотрен пример сравнения и синхронизации двух баз данных Microsoft SQL Server. Кроме того, Вы узнаете, зачем вообще может потребоваться выполнять данную процедуру.
На сегодня это все, надеюсь, подборка была Вам полезна, пока!
Приглашаю всех желающих пройти мои онлайн-курсы по изучению языка T-SQL – https://self-learning.ru/courses/t-sql
На курсах используется моя авторская последовательная методика обучения и рассматриваются все конструкции языка SQL и T-SQL. Каждый курс включает огромное количество материалов: видео, текстовый материал, тесты, домашние задания, скрипты, а также сертификат о прохождении.
На курсах Вы можете заниматься в комфортном для себя темпе не выходя из дома в любое удобное для Вас время.